Morgan Stanley is looking for a Risk Governance Associate who will join the team.
The role will reside within the EMEA Firm Risk Management's Risk Governance team. The role is responsible for supporting the Risk Division's engagement with the UK and European regulators. This includes providing independent review and challenge of all regulatory submissions and providing advice and support to large-scale regulatory remediation projects with respect to regulatory expectations. The role is responsible for regulatory engagement on a wide range of topics, including credit risk and traded risks, and will collaborate with teams across regions.

What will you be doing?
- Support Firm Risk Management's engagement with the PRA and the ECB, including, but not limited to, preparation of on-site visits / workshops and information requests; compiling, reviewing & challenging submission materials
- Assist with regulatory self-assessments which are either required for regulatory model applications, assessment against new regulations or which support the Risk Division in ensuring ongoing regulatory compliance
- Support large-scale regulatory remediation projects, providing advice on regulatory expectations and reviewing and challenging documentation supporting the closure of project milestones / regulatory findings
- Assist in reviewing Risk policies and procedures to ensure regulatory requirements are appropriately reflected
- Assist in monitoring the EMEA Risk related regulatory landscape to identify and socialise relevant regulatory publications and to ensure appropriate next steps are taken
What we're looking for:
- Bachelor's degree or equivalent
- Experience in working on regulatory issues or regulatory implementation projects (e.g. regulatory applications for internal model applications)
- Experience in Risk Management at leading financial institutions (preferred)
- Knowledge of risk related elements of the PRA and/or ECB regulatory rulebooks
